IF you get your hands on the conservation Tranq Rifle, then the Kuaka and Condrocs are your debt bonds.

Stepping out of the gate, straight ahead there is a group of them most of the time. If you are using Loki, or another invis frame, then you get standing easily this way.

Sure, this isn't really a strategy for newer players, but OP talked about veterans...
